Materials used for patching vary with the asphalt damage. A contractor may use hot mix asphalt, asphalt emulsion mixes, or proprietary patching mixes with unique blends. The contractor will then determine the patching technique and the material required by evaluating the extent of damage to the asphalt pavement. The following are a few patching techniques used for repairing crevices or fissures.

  • Throw and Roll – Although temporary, throw, and roll is a very effective patching technique in emergencies. It involves the use of liquid asphalt that is filled into the damaged area and is rolled over. The liquid is applied to the compromised section in layers. It then solidifies over time from exposure to air.
  • Semi-permanent patches – It lasts longer than the throw and roll technique. However, it does require a complete surface preparation. Water, debris, chemicals, and contaminants are removed with a vacuum or an air compressor. The defected region is then cut with hand tools or power equipment. The pothole or the crevice is then filled with the patching mix and rolled over.
  • Spray-injection – This method is generally preferred to overthrow and roll, and involves the use of truck-mounted equipment. Contractors extract water and debris out of the fault, and inject emulsified liquid and aggregator into it. The high-pressure injection eliminates the requirement for compaction. The method is valid under adverse circumstances.

Improvements in surface performance and lifespan can be induced with slurry seal surfacing. All the gaps, voids, and eroded areas are filled with a sealer, resulting in a non-skid surface.
